Downspout Repair
Original downspouts on Albany’s historic homes are often 2×3-inch galvanized steel, undersized for modern roof areas and corroded from decades of salt-laden fog. We replace them with 3×4-inch seamless aluminum, properly strapped and extended to direct water away from foundations. Downspout replacement alone typically runs $280-$520 per run in Albany.

Fascia Repair
This is where Albany’s gutter problems become structural. Original redwood fascia boards on 1920s-1940s homes rot from the back side when clogged gutters hold moisture against them. By the time you see paint peeling, the damage is often extensive. We replace rotted fascia with primed cedar or composite material, properly flashed and integrated with your gutter system. Fascia repair combined with gutter replacement on a typical Albany bungalow runs $2,400-$3,800.

Common Gutters & Accessories Problems We See in Albany Homes
- Seamless gutters pull apart at joints due to differential expansion in cold marine moisture cycles, especially on north-facing roof sections shaded by mature street trees. The constant fog-cool-warm cycle stresses every connection point.
- Downspouts clog with dense moss-and-leaf paste that holds moisture against clapboard siding, accelerating rot in historic homes. This slurry forms nowhere else in the East Bay quite like it does in Albany’s compressed coastal microclimate.
- Original copper or galvanized gutters on 1920s-1940s homes develop pinhole leaks from decades of salt-laden fog, requiring full replacement rather than spot repair. We’ve seen original gutters with paper-thin bottoms that a finger could press through.
- Moss mats on north-facing roof slopes physically lift asphalt shingle tabs and create ice-dam-style pooling during heavy rain, overwhelming gutters that were already marginal. This pattern appears on the majority of pre-1960 tearoffs we perform in Albany.

No. Albany’s winter temperatures rarely drop below freezing for extended periods, and true ice dam conditions are uncommon here. The pooling and overflow you see are caused by blockages, not ice. Heated cables add unnecessary cost and electrical load. Proper gutter guards and functional downspouts address the actual problem.
